UPDATE: AbbVie (ABBV) Guides Q3 EPS Below Views
July 24, 2015 9:37 AM EDT(Updated - July 24, 2015 9:45 AM EDT)
AbbVie (NYSE: ABBV) sees Q3 EPS of 1.05 - $1.07, with estimates at $1.09.

Key Events from the Second Quarter
On May 26, AbbVie successfully completed the acquisition of Pharmacyclics, accelerating AbbVie's clinical and commercial presence in oncology.
